Russia’s aluminum exports to US fall in Jan-Aug

According to the latest statistics from the US Geological Survey, Russia exported around 5,000 tons of aluminum products (crude metal and alloys, semi-finished products, and scrap) in August, dropping by 40% year on year; the figure in the first eight months of this year reached roughly 92,500 tons, sliding by 93% compared to the same period a year ago.

In addition, Russia’s exports of crude metals and alloys to the US amounted to around 3,400 tons in August, down by 25.22% from the previous month and also dropping by 56% year on year.

In the first eight months, Russia exported nearly 78,000 tons of crude metals and alloys to the US, a year-on-year decline of 38%.
